Abstract
The effects of shape and position of load application on the magnitude and position of the peak stresses in stepped bars and around T-slots are determined from photoelastic models. Stress concentration factors for any practical shape can be quickly determined from the results. Stress concentration factors at these unsymmetrical projections are related to previously published factors for symmetrical projections.
